Ventilation Fan Repair in Alpharetta, GA
Ventilation fan repair services focus on restoring proper airflow and ventilation in residential properties. These services cover a range of projects, including fixing bathroom exhaust fans, kitchen range hoods, attic ventilators, and other mechanical fans that help maintain indoor air quality. Property owners typically seek repairs when fans stop functioning, operate noisily, or fail to effectively ventilate spaces, which can lead to increased humidity, odors, or mold growth.
Homeowners and property owners should understand the specific type of ventilation fan installed in their space, as different models and systems may require tailored repair approaches. It’s also helpful to know the location of the fan, any recent issues experienced, and whether there are signs of electrical problems or physical damage. Clear information about the fan’s age, usage, and symptoms can assist in determining the most appropriate repair solution.

Ventilation Fan Repair Questions
What are common signs of a ventilation fan that needs repair? Unusual noises, reduced airflow, or persistent odors can indicate issues requiring attention.
Can a ventilation fan be repaired instead of replaced? Many problems can be fixed through repairs, but some cases may require replacement for optimal performance.
What types of ventilation fans are typically serviced? Exhaust fans in bathrooms, kitchen range hoods, and attic ventilation fans are common repair projects.
Is it necessary to turn off power before repair work? Yes, disconnecting power ensures safety during maintenance or repair of ventilation fans.
